ANMF Newsflash: Medea Park
The Australian Nursing and Midwifery Federation Tasmanian Branch (ANMF) has received confirmation from Medea Park CEO, Deb Austen that the wage increase for the Medea Park Association Incorporated Nurses Agreement 2019, was applied from 1 July 2020 (as previously agreed to and understood).
Medea Park conducted an audit on a randomly allocated staff members’ pay slips to ensure the wage increase had been applied.
